FRAME-RELAY-DTE-MIB
66 objects
The MIB module to describe the use of a Frame Relay interface by a DTE.

| 1.3.6.1.2.1.10.32.1 | TablefrDlcmiTable | not-accessible | current | The Parameters for the Data Link Connection Management Interface for the frame relay service on this interface. |
| 1.3.6.1.2.1.10.32.1.1 | RowfrDlcmiEntry | not-accessible | current | The Parameters for a particular Data Link Connection Management Interface. |
| 1.3.6.1.2.1.10.32.1.1.1 | ColumnfrDlcmiIfIndex | read-only | current | The ifIndex value of the corresponding ifEntry. |
| 1.3.6.1.2.1.10.32.1.1.2 | ColumnfrDlcmiState | read-create | current | This variable states which Data Link Connection Management scheme is active (and by implication, what DLCI it uses) on the Frame Relay interface. |
| 1.3.6.1.2.1.10.32.1.1.3 | ColumnfrDlcmiAddress | read-create | current | This variable states which address format is in use on the Frame Relay interface. |
| 1.3.6.1.2.1.10.32.1.1.4 | ColumnfrDlcmiAddressLen | read-create | current | This variable states the address length in octets. In the case of Q922 format, the length indicates the entire length of the address including the control port… |
| 1.3.6.1.2.1.10.32.1.1.5 | ColumnfrDlcmiPollingInterval | read-create | current | This is the number of seconds between successive status enquiry messages. |
| 1.3.6.1.2.1.10.32.1.1.6 | ColumnfrDlcmiFullEnquiryInterval | read-create | current | Number of status enquiry intervals that pass before issuance of a full status enquiry message. |
| 1.3.6.1.2.1.10.32.1.1.7 | ColumnfrDlcmiErrorThreshold | read-create | current | This is the maximum number of unanswered Status Enquiries the equipment shall accept before declaring the interface down. |
| 1.3.6.1.2.1.10.32.1.1.8 | ColumnfrDlcmiMonitoredEvents | read-create | current | This is the number of status polling intervals over which the error threshold is counted. For example, if within 'MonitoredEvents' number of events the station… |
| 1.3.6.1.2.1.10.32.1.1.9 | ColumnfrDlcmiMaxSupportedVCs | read-create | current | The maximum number of Virtual Circuits allowed for this interface. Usually dictated by the Frame Relay network. In response to a SET, if a value less than zero… |
| 1.3.6.1.2.1.10.32.1.1.10 | ColumnfrDlcmiMulticast | read-create | current | This indicates whether the Frame Relay interface is using a multicast service. |
| 1.3.6.1.2.1.10.32.1.1.11 | ColumnfrDlcmiStatus | read-only | current | This indicates the status of the Frame Relay interface as determined by the performance of the dlcmi. If no dlcmi is running, the Frame Relay interface will st… |
| 1.3.6.1.2.1.10.32.1.1.12 | ColumnfrDlcmiRowStatus | read-create | current | SNMP Version 2 Row Status Variable. Writable objects in the table may be written in any RowStatus state. |
| 1.3.6.1.2.1.10.32.2 | TablefrCircuitTable | not-accessible | current | A table containing information about specific Data Link Connections (DLC) or virtual circuits. |
| 1.3.6.1.2.1.10.32.2.1 | RowfrCircuitEntry | not-accessible | current | The information regarding a single Data Link Connection. Discontinuities in the counters contained in this table are indicated by the value in frCircuitCreatio… |
| 1.3.6.1.2.1.10.32.2.1.1 | ColumnfrCircuitIfIndex | read-only | current | The ifIndex Value of the ifEntry this virtual circuit is layered onto. |
| 1.3.6.1.2.1.10.32.2.1.2 | ColumnfrCircuitDlci | read-only | current | The Data Link Connection Identifier for this virtual circuit. |
| 1.3.6.1.2.1.10.32.2.1.3 | ColumnfrCircuitState | read-create | current | Indicates whether the particular virtual circuit is operational. In the absence of a Data Link Connection Management Interface, virtual circuit entries (rows) … |
| 1.3.6.1.2.1.10.32.2.1.4 | ColumnfrCircuitReceivedFECNs | read-only | current | Number of frames received from the network indicating forward congestion since the virtual circuit was created. This occurs when the remote DTE sets the FECN f… |
| 1.3.6.1.2.1.10.32.2.1.5 | ColumnfrCircuitReceivedBECNs | read-only | current | Number of frames received from the network indicating backward congestion since the virtual circuit was created. This occurs when the remote DTE sets the BECN … |
| 1.3.6.1.2.1.10.32.2.1.6 | ColumnfrCircuitSentFrames | read-only | current | The number of frames sent from this virtual circuit since it was created. |
| 1.3.6.1.2.1.10.32.2.1.7 | ColumnfrCircuitSentOctets | read-only | current | The number of octets sent from this virtual circuit since it was created. Octets counted are the full frame relay header and the payload, but do not include th… |
| 1.3.6.1.2.1.10.32.2.1.8 | ColumnfrCircuitReceivedFrames | read-only | current | Number of frames received over this virtual circuit since it was created. |
| 1.3.6.1.2.1.10.32.2.1.9 | ColumnfrCircuitReceivedOctets | read-only | current | Number of octets received over this virtual circuit since it was created. Octets counted include the full frame relay header, but do not include the flag chara… |
| 1.3.6.1.2.1.10.32.2.1.10 | ColumnfrCircuitCreationTime | read-only | current | The value of sysUpTime when the virtual circuit was created, whether by the Data Link Connection Management Interface or by a SetRequest. |
| 1.3.6.1.2.1.10.32.2.1.11 | ColumnfrCircuitLastTimeChange | read-only | current | The value of sysUpTime when last there was a change in the virtual circuit state |
| 1.3.6.1.2.1.10.32.2.1.12 | ColumnfrCircuitCommittedBurst | read-create | current | This variable indicates the maximum amount of data, in bits, that the network agrees to transfer under normal conditions, during the measurement interval. |
| 1.3.6.1.2.1.10.32.2.1.13 | ColumnfrCircuitExcessBurst | read-create | current | This variable indicates the maximum amount of uncommitted data bits that the network will attempt to deliver over the measurement interval. By default, if not … |
| 1.3.6.1.2.1.10.32.2.1.14 | ColumnfrCircuitThroughput | read-create | current | Throughput is the average number of 'Frame Relay Information Field' bits transferred per second across a user network interface in one direction, measured over… |
| 1.3.6.1.2.1.10.32.2.1.15 | ColumnfrCircuitMulticast | read-create | current | This indicates whether this VC is used as a unicast VC (i.e. not multicast) or the type of multicast service subscribed to |
| 1.3.6.1.2.1.10.32.2.1.16 | ColumnfrCircuitType | read-only | current | Indication of whether the VC was manually created (static), or dynamically created (dynamic) via the data link control management interface. |
| 1.3.6.1.2.1.10.32.2.1.17 | ColumnfrCircuitDiscards | read-only | current | The number of inbound frames dropped because of format errors, or because the VC is inactive. |
| 1.3.6.1.2.1.10.32.2.1.18 | ColumnfrCircuitReceivedDEs | read-only | current | Number of frames received from the network indicating that they were eligible for discard since the virtual circuit was created. This occurs when the remote DT… |
| 1.3.6.1.2.1.10.32.2.1.19 | ColumnfrCircuitSentDEs | read-only | current | Number of frames sent to the network indicating that they were eligible for discard since the virtual circuit was created. This occurs when the local DTE sets … |
| 1.3.6.1.2.1.10.32.2.1.20 | ColumnfrCircuitLogicalIfIndex | read-create | current | Normally the same value as frDlcmiIfIndex, but different when an implementation associates a virtual ifEntry with a DLC or set of DLCs in order to associate hi… |
| 1.3.6.1.2.1.10.32.2.1.21 | ColumnfrCircuitRowStatus | read-create | current | This object is used to create a new row or modify or destroy an existing row in the manner described in the definition of the RowStatus textual convention. Wri… |
| 1.3.6.1.2.1.10.32.3 | TablefrErrTable | not-accessible | current | A table containing information about Errors on the Frame Relay interface. Discontinuities in the counters contained in this table are the same as apply to the … |
| 1.3.6.1.2.1.10.32.3.1 | RowfrErrEntry | not-accessible | current | The error information for a single frame relay interface. |
| 1.3.6.1.2.1.10.32.3.1.1 | ColumnfrErrIfIndex | read-only | current | The ifIndex Value of the corresponding ifEntry. |
| 1.3.6.1.2.1.10.32.3.1.2 | ColumnfrErrType | read-only | current | The type of error that was last seen on this interface: receiveShort: frame was not long enough to allow demultiplexing - the address field was incomplete, or … |
| 1.3.6.1.2.1.10.32.3.1.3 | ColumnfrErrData | read-only | current | An octet string containing as much of the error packet as possible. As a minimum, it must contain the Q.922 Address or as much as was delivered. It is desirabl… |
| 1.3.6.1.2.1.10.32.3.1.4 | ColumnfrErrTime | read-only | current | The value of sysUpTime at which the error was detected. |
| 1.3.6.1.2.1.10.32.3.1.5 | ColumnfrErrFaults | read-only | current | The number of times the interface has gone down since it was initialized. |
| 1.3.6.1.2.1.10.32.3.1.6 | ColumnfrErrFaultTime | read-only | current | The value of sysUpTime at the time when the interface was taken down due to excessive errors. Excessive errors is defined as the time when a DLCMI exceeds the … |
| 1.3.6.1.2.1.10.32.4 | NodeframeRelayTrapControl | |||
| 1.3.6.1.2.1.10.32.4.1 | ScalarfrTrapState | read-write | current | This variable indicates whether the system produces the frDLCIStatusChange trap. |
| 1.3.6.1.2.1.10.32.4.2 | ScalarfrTrapMaxRate | read-write | current | This variable indicates the number of milliseconds that must elapse between trap emissions. If events occur more rapidly, the impementation may simply fail to … |

Type Definitions
| Name | Syntax | Status | Description |
|---|---|---|---|
| DLCI | Integer32(0..8388607) | current | The range of DLCI values. Note that this varies by interface configuration; normally, interfaces may use 0..1023, but may be configured to use ranges as large as 0..2^23. |
